One significant aspect is the chassis itself. Vehicles like the Sprinter van, often utilized as a base for travel van conversions, are known for their Mercedes-Benz engineering, including features like Electronic Stability Program (ESP). Older Sprinter models might have Dodge bodies, but the underlying chassis and safety systems remain Mercedes-Benz. A point of discussion is the rear wheel configuration, with longer Sprinters sometimes featuring dual rear wheels. Theoretically, dual wheels enhance rear stability, especially in crosswinds. However, single rear wheel configurations, as found on some Sprinter models, are also favored by some drivers. Personal experiences, such as maintaining tire pressures at 55psi in the front and 80psi in the rear for single rear wheel setups, suggest fine-tuning can optimize handling and mitigate issues like oversteer at higher speeds. Strong winds, especially for taller RVs or those with front overhangs, can pose considerable handling challenges, regardless of the chassis.
Another common chassis in the travel van market is Ford. Online forums and discussions often mention debates regarding Ford front-end geometry and perceived “looseness.” This could stem from various factors, including tire pressure, driving habits, road quality, wind conditions, or even overloading. Some speculate that the issue might be linked to a lack of rear stabilizers. Comparisons with other chassis brands, like Chevrolet, sometimes highlight the Stabiltrak system in Chevrolets as potentially offering superior front-end stability compared to Ford. While wheel alignment is often suggested as a solution for handling issues in Ford-based RVs, anecdotal evidence suggests it’s not always a definitive fix.
When considering a travel van purchase, the choice between single or dual rear wheels is a recurring theme. While dual rear wheels are often associated with increased stability, especially in larger RVs, some drivers express a preference for single rear wheels, particularly on a Mercedes-Benz chassis. The tighter handling and car-like tracking of the MB chassis with single rear wheels are appreciated. Furthermore, practical considerations like parking regulations in urban environments can also influence this preference, as dual-wheel vehicles might face stricter parking enforcement in some cities.
